Yesterday Mr Hogwe revealed that 40 more lawyers have been added to the list. He said they have barred 40 lawyers from practising for various reasons.
27 lawyers are from Harare, five from Bulawayo and the rest from different towns. Hogwe said “As the Law Society, we take stock to check which lawyers do not have PCs.
“If any of them have been practising, we charge them. So by publishing the list we want to protect the public. What we do is that at the beginning of each year, we renew Practising Certificates and before a lawyer can obtain a Practising Certificate, their law firm should have a clean audit certificate.
“Besides the audit certificate, the lawyer has to pay Practising certificate fees and subscriptions. So I would not say that a PC is not granted for one reason because they vary. For lawyers whose status reads ‘Application Denied’, they might be having pending acts of misconduct or their audit certificates are not clean.”
